On 13/Apr/16 02:29, Colton Conor wrote:

Someone told me to check out extreme networks, cisco or Ciena for the
more cost effective mpls kit. Any advice on which of the three would have
the most cost effective 10G MPLS switch?

Cisco's MPLS switch is the ASR 920 right?


The useful ones are the ASR920 and ME3600X/3800X.

The ASR920 is the way forward, and is generally half the price of the
ME3600X.
